lifeisrealygood Posted May 13, 2018 #10 Share Posted May 13, 2018 For many of us who received the "classic" beverage package as a perk, yes, we want to upgrade to the "premium" package. You cannot do this on-line. I have done this upgrade on my last seven or eight cruises. You just call Celebrity, tell them you want to upgrade to the "premium" package, and they will do it for you. The cost currently is $10 per day, plus the 18% gratuity. Even if you used a travel agent, you can still do this yourself. You need not go through the travel agent. Super easy to do, but you need to call. 1 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
